Gilberto Gil, at 84 years old, returns to Portugal to perform at Coliseu dos Recreios on October 10. The Brazilian musician takes the opportunity to talk about the show he brings to us, in a concert that marks his return to the country.

The article recalls that Gilberto Gil made his debut in Portugal in 1969, a significant date in his international career. This new performance represents a continuation of a long-standing relationship with the Portuguese audience.

Regarding aging, Gilberto Gil shares his personal reflections on the process of growing old, a topic he addresses with naturalness in the interview.

The musician also remembers his daughter Preta, who died last year, expressing the pain of her absence: "Preta is greatly missed and leaves us with great longing," the artist states, showing the personal and emotional side of this visit to Portugal.

Octopus folar with samphire brings Ria Formosa flavors to FATACIL

An octopus folar with samphire, inspired by the flavors of Fuzeta and Ria Formosa, was presented at FATACIL in Lagoa, in an initiative by the Associação KlubeSol and the Confraria Marinha da Ria Formosa. The octopus, an emblematic product of local fishing, combines with samphire, known as the "green salt" of Ria Formosa, in a recipe that unites traditional techniques with a contemporary approach. The organization aims to disseminate Algarve gastronomic heritage and use these products as instruments for territorial valorization and local development.

Rice conquers Moncofa: 18 establishments join a ten-year anniversary event

The Moncofa Town Hall promotes the tenth edition of the Gastronomic Days of Rice and Paella, an event that has established itself as one of the main gastronomic proposals in the local calendar. Until September 13, 18 establishments will participate in this culinary celebration, offering neighbors, visitors and tourists a wide selection of traditional recipes and more innovative proposals around rice, one of the most representative products of Valencian gastronomy.

Big Band do Centro Cultural da Guarda debuted this Saturday

The Centro Cultural da Guarda presented this Saturday its new Big Band, a musical project dedicated to jazz and blues, under the direction of trumpeter André Santos. The group's first concert took place in the courtyard of Paço da Cultura, marking the start of this cultural initiative that aims to boost the musical offering of the space.
